Mood & Stitching Personality: Playful, Not Precious

The Happy Starfish Design lands firmly in the playful and cute spectrum—but avoids tipping into juvenile or overly cartoonish territory. Its rounded limbs, slightly asymmetrical posture, and gentle smile (implied through stitch flow, not literal line work) give it personality without sacrificing elegance. As a machine embroidery design, it balances detail and wearability: no micro-stitching that’ll snag on fleece, no dense fill areas that’ll stiffen lightweight sweatshirts. Instead, it uses smart satin borders, open-stitch body sections, and a light appliqué foundation that lifts just enough to catch light—perfect for creating dimension on cozy, textured fabrics.

One reminder: Always verify hoop size compatibility, stitch count (for time/cost estimates), and license terms before bulk production—especially if you plan to offer finished products commercially. While the description confirms multiple embroidery file formats and color-separated steps, confirm whether your machine brand (Brother, Janome, Bernina, etc.) is explicitly supported. When in doubt, request a test stitch-out from the designer or vendor. A few minutes now saves hours later.
